From 7ea053fda5a5d9f9581779a5a17f5852b25e2a02 Mon Sep 17 00:00:00 2001 From: Jan Kohnert <jan@jan-kohnert.de> Date: Sun, 19 May 2024 20:55:02 +0200 Subject: [PATCH 1/2] Updated ebuilds. --- www-apps/drupal/drupal-10.2.4.ebuild | 71 ------------------- ...pal-10.2.3.ebuild => drupal-10.2.6.ebuild} | 0 2 files changed, 71 deletions(-) delete mode 100644 www-apps/drupal/drupal-10.2.4.ebuild rename www-apps/drupal/{drupal-10.2.3.ebuild => drupal-10.2.6.ebuild} (100%) diff --git a/www-apps/drupal/drupal-10.2.4.ebuild b/www-apps/drupal/drupal-10.2.4.ebuild deleted file mode 100644 index 3a1a01b..0000000 --- a/www-apps/drupal/drupal-10.2.4.ebuild +++ /dev/null @@ -1,71 +0,0 @@ -# Copyright 1999-2023 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=8 - -inherit webapp - -MY_PV=${PV:0:3}.0 -MY_P=${P/_/-} -S="${WORKDIR}/${MY_P}" - -DESCRIPTION="PHP-based open-source platform and content management system" -HOMEPAGE="https://www.drupal.org/" -SRC_URI="https://ftp.drupal.org/files/projects/${MY_P}.tar.gz" - -LICENSE="GPL-2" -KEYWORDS="~amd64 ~x86" -IUSE="+mysql postgres sqlite +uploadprogress" - -# upstream supports php 8.1+, but dev-php/pecl-uploadprogress does not have 8.2 -# limit php to 8.1 for now -RDEPEND=" - dev-lang/php[gd,hash(+),mysql?,pdo,postgres?,simplexml,sqlite?,xml] - virtual/httpd-php - uploadprogress? ( dev-php/pecl-uploadprogress ) -" - -need_httpd_cgi - -REQUIRED_USE="|| ( mysql postgres sqlite )" - -src_install() { - webapp_src_preinst - - local docs="LICENSE.txt README.md core/MAINTAINERS.txt core/INSTALL.txt core/CHANGELOG.txt \ - core/INSTALL.mysql.txt core/INSTALL.pgsql.txt core/INSTALL.sqlite.txt core/UPDATE.txt \ - core/USAGE.txt " - - dodoc ${docs} - rm ${docs} core/COPYRIGHT.txt core/LICENSE.txt || die - - cp sites/default/{default.settings.php,settings.php} || die - insinto "${MY_HTDOCSDIR}" - doins -r . - - dodir "${MY_HTDOCSDIR}"/files - webapp_serverowned "${MY_HTDOCSDIR}"/files - - webapp_configfile "${MY_HTDOCSDIR}"/sites/default/settings.php - webapp_configfile "${MY_HTDOCSDIR}"/.htaccess - - webapp_postinst_txt en "${FILESDIR}"/postinstall-en.txt - - webapp_src_install -} - -pkg_postinst() { - echo - ewarn "SECURITY NOTICE" - ewarn "If you plan on using SSL on your Drupal site, please consult the postinstall information:" - ewarn "\t# webapp-config --show-postinst ${PN} ${PV}" - echo - ewarn "If this is a new install, unless you want anyone with network access to your server to be" - ewarn "able to run the setup, you'll have to configure your web server to limit access to it." - echo - ewarn "If you're doing a new drupal-10 install, you'll have to copy /sites/default/default.services.yml" - ewarn "to /sites/default/services.yml and grant it write permissions to your web server." - ewarn "Just follow the instructions of the drupal setup and be sure to resolve any permissions issue" - ewarn "reported by the setup." - echo -} diff --git a/www-apps/drupal/drupal-10.2.3.ebuild b/www-apps/drupal/drupal-10.2.6.ebuild similarity index 100% rename from www-apps/drupal/drupal-10.2.3.ebuild rename to www-apps/drupal/drupal-10.2.6.ebuild -- GitLab From 6bd366eef28cbe277b4419b6ea1f2ac94c907eaf Mon Sep 17 00:00:00 2001 From: Jan Kohnert <jan@jan-kohnert.de> Date: Sun, 19 May 2024 20:56:48 +0200 Subject: [PATCH 2/2] Updated manifest. --- www-apps/drupal/Manifest |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/www-apps/drupal/Manifest b/www-apps/drupal/Manifest index 22c5bf5..437ef8f 100644 --- a/www-apps/drupal/Manifest +++ b/www-apps/drupal/Manifest @@ -1,9 +1,7 @@ AUX postinstall-en.txt 1730 BLAKE2B b335309795d753c7689338c5e94b596efa5f66dc8dee17ad30b1a2d10b694a7bc288597b526239ea1d443887b45b8cd8ef89b499b79e86ab5df1c195ee85d4a0 SHA512 4ae14616c49e6aa61dc781350b5a75defefc2f894b98422a5b69a5827e367eb00fce140e6a45bcc02c90f068fc31970512d2632bbbf398cbe34f947933990050 DIST drupal-10.1.4.tar.gz 18271854 BLAKE2B ae8648c96c24535ba94ad61e1ce4e8462c2946313236370f5e80ecccb597be1ae4ada13270605e239b927b3e2d2ef46bf5de928a4e2c8897cece406af9e6a606 SHA512 50d4fa117a67889f608463bb20bd7f1cace41d2a60d061fd82032c1c06a77cf9e692a2f3750cf92b5b3a7c0c6b85944477e7bdc52196e394fdd07e85caaee375 -DIST drupal-10.2.3.tar.gz 18960477 BLAKE2B 7d3b6d0daf832e91c9f4a36a757e3f19ea0e63cfc55027b160627398e1fc0ee314b8dd2a6c005eeb57d21a4bd90f87a6f628dd83c828817315f93f8c7b83fc54 SHA512 238f8656b4ff0f506b0f77dd854fdc61a28afa09a8d4a7082260a6d9e96dca257f1fdbfbf4c00052ee3a9fad112876fa28ca9004a130aff4900a2b65636adc03 -DIST drupal-10.2.4.tar.gz 18970320 BLAKE2B b383fa0b2da8eb4485424ef439d8d7c70d936bf935343dac4af3d565aed2b6366bf969935e3a1d2bfa0cfe266ff410b487bc50ac8b13fa9463fac651747cd7d1 SHA512 bfd084a8ccf9acd2d4f829e23340779f11de9a21127dd93405eb12b4d3dcaacf7d08459c9cf68f1adb77ef5a801143998ce0e2dc5b271f0354898860d258729a DIST drupal-10.2.5.tar.gz 18977447 BLAKE2B ee335880fa16fc8d6a1f439035909e4fd2392d37fd5dd38878f57db7e28ad5d3c4ea15fd8e361ff59b2283d3afffc9c8ad1178041e12b95fa6af3039379fdcfa SHA512 123a14db6293bac1579e2bd762dd9af52249eb749ae8caf8bdbd0a2a244c267f4d71e57ec7264385568deca64991b89b0656d4a62bec66d10e45e0cb3d280944 +DIST drupal-10.2.6.tar.gz 18977659 BLAKE2B 57b7b7529e5d5665eb1a6b413120df7d0d0cf75338cf3e85c328620c58ef48e0180b9326daed996458d01b4903f6d4f64a7774e42d043244ed8e549ce8ce9cfc SHA512 5a8c24a539c3bf514d95dea779811cd02e1e3313792b0a32af007f1be5919c431a6d0bb0cccdb3db2283de50d94311192005a291800fbc3ea20b9c6aefc921e5 EBUILD drupal-10.1.4.ebuild 2194 BLAKE2B 1ba6c6acc0db6b3b385f9d875b85d237b2767d84caae72832e745ca46c7151d799ad52e22e3f2b6ced8286d542203867adab3ec740bcb5d3a3503cfe394dfd03 SHA512 eb7c9e1563c3e3c4e262018c8ca16e6a17e4d7ed3ef3ac5be8693904da1e3f3fb9c3326e025f3479e0a0e76843c7f93ed3e21e7d2f5594f4bd019960fcc7276f -EBUILD drupal-10.2.3.ebuild 2194 BLAKE2B 1ba6c6acc0db6b3b385f9d875b85d237b2767d84caae72832e745ca46c7151d799ad52e22e3f2b6ced8286d542203867adab3ec740bcb5d3a3503cfe394dfd03 SHA512 eb7c9e1563c3e3c4e262018c8ca16e6a17e4d7ed3ef3ac5be8693904da1e3f3fb9c3326e025f3479e0a0e76843c7f93ed3e21e7d2f5594f4bd019960fcc7276f -EBUILD drupal-10.2.4.ebuild 2194 BLAKE2B 1ba6c6acc0db6b3b385f9d875b85d237b2767d84caae72832e745ca46c7151d799ad52e22e3f2b6ced8286d542203867adab3ec740bcb5d3a3503cfe394dfd03 SHA512 eb7c9e1563c3e3c4e262018c8ca16e6a17e4d7ed3ef3ac5be8693904da1e3f3fb9c3326e025f3479e0a0e76843c7f93ed3e21e7d2f5594f4bd019960fcc7276f EBUILD drupal-10.2.5.ebuild 2194 BLAKE2B 1ba6c6acc0db6b3b385f9d875b85d237b2767d84caae72832e745ca46c7151d799ad52e22e3f2b6ced8286d542203867adab3ec740bcb5d3a3503cfe394dfd03 SHA512 eb7c9e1563c3e3c4e262018c8ca16e6a17e4d7ed3ef3ac5be8693904da1e3f3fb9c3326e025f3479e0a0e76843c7f93ed3e21e7d2f5594f4bd019960fcc7276f +EBUILD drupal-10.2.6.ebuild 2194 BLAKE2B 1ba6c6acc0db6b3b385f9d875b85d237b2767d84caae72832e745ca46c7151d799ad52e22e3f2b6ced8286d542203867adab3ec740bcb5d3a3503cfe394dfd03 SHA512 eb7c9e1563c3e3c4e262018c8ca16e6a17e4d7ed3ef3ac5be8693904da1e3f3fb9c3326e025f3479e0a0e76843c7f93ed3e21e7d2f5594f4bd019960fcc7276f -- GitLab